Sushant Singh Rajput's Kedarnath co-actor Shahab Ali talks about his experience of working with late actor

Updated : Jun 24, 2021, 22:12 IST323 views

Bollywood actor Shahab Ali featured in a recently released OTT series and is currently basking in the success of the same. The series also features Manoj Bajpyee in a lead role. Shahab has also worked with late actor Sushant Singh Rajput in 'Kedarnath' and in a recent interview with Times Now Digital he opened about his experience of working with SSR. He said, 'My experience with Sushant was amazing. Because I remember I did not have a scene with him but still he asked me to come and rehearse with him. I said 'Arey but I do not have a scene with you, it's a flashback scene bacche ke saath hai mera'. He said ya but I have to speak those lines in a scene with Sara. So I want to listen to those lines, because agar mere father mujhe bachpan mein bolte the vo line toh abhi mere father film mein kaise bol rahe hai vaise hi main use memory launga. So I was so impressed by the way he was so dedicated towards his work that even if we didn't have a scene together, he rehearsed with me. He was so enthusiastic about it and I got really impressed by it. It is really sad that he is not with us anymore but he was amazing.' The actor mentioned that he used to watch and observe him during the shoot and he found Sushant's performance to be mind blowing. 'It was difficult to shoot in Kedarnath because he was playing that pithoo ka character. So vo basket leke mein ek insaan ko bithake slop par aap chadh rahe ho lagatar, you are giving so many retakes, 10-12 retakes if you are giving, you are physically exhausted but he used to do it with so much passion. He was really good. ' On a concluding note, Shahab said his overall experience working on 'Kedarnath' was just okay because he did not have a big part. He said, 'However, I was excited about that film because they told me they were shooting in 'Kedarnath' only. So I was like 'Kedarnarth' jaane milega, isse zyada positive aur shubh chiz nahi ho sakti. Bas I thought of that and the fact Sushant was there (in the film), ye do cheeze thi mere liye aur kuch nahi tha.'
